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24171121327 5128162239 78579
87001042530 821
87001042530 821
00583 10456 2422 37316 094
All about undefined
Interested in learning more?
87001042530 821
00583 10456 2422 37316 094
See more
550623 116903295
592914 37640 81300 676898
See more
849338 30 875891049
42067177 4916588920 23355
See more